Harare arts festival attracts thousands of arts lovers

No Image

HARARE: Harare International Festival of the Arts (HIFA) is a paradise for lovers of the arts.

HIFA is a six-day annual event that showcases Zimbabwean, regional and international arts and culture in a comprehensive festival programme of theatre, dance, music, circus, street performance, spoken-word and visual arts.

Even Zimbabwe's political and economic situation was not a hindrance to the arts lovers across the world, including this writer, who joined the pilgrimage to Harare Gardens for the 2011 festival themed, The Engagement Party.
